To edit or add a New Page To edit any page click on Pages tab on the left hand menu and then click the page you want to edit. You will now see a complete list of the pages where you can delete or hide pages if needed. If you rollover the page title you have the following options: Edit, Quick Edit, Trash, View 5
Once clicked on a page you can edit the content. Once you have finished, you can preview the changes or press Update to save the changes and upload to make live. The title of the page is in the first field at the top. To add a new page, click new page link on the left. When adding new page, enter title and content and then choose which section and what template the page should have. Again, preview or press update buttons to check and make page live. To add images to the site There are a number of ways to add images to the site. The best way is to click the Media tab on the left hand menu. Here you can view all the images already in the site library. Just click Add New on the menu and follow the instructions. You can upload or drag and drop multiple images which will get added to the Image library and you can use for the Posts or Pages. You can also delete images from here as well. 1
